Being a victim of the 12 and under limit is agonizing. So I’m writing to all the restaurants of America, and possibly the world, to let them know that kids menus are boring. Let me just say, having to eat the same items over and over is not fun.
As a pre-teen, I don’t like the idea of kids having a separate menu just because of age.I guess restaurants, and their owners, don’t take into account that we are young adults and we might just want smaller portions from the better menu.I would rather have a mini filet mignon than the usual options of chicken fingers, pizza, buttered noodles, and other simple foods.But seldom do I find a smaller portion of the “regular menu” foods.And I know that I usually steal off my parents plates just because their food looks better.
